The Moonlight Sonata 🌙
Ludwig van Beethoven's Piano Sonata No. 14 in C-sharp minor, marked as "Op. 27, No. 2" and commonly known as the Moonlight Sonata, is one of his most acclaimed compositions. A beautiful, emotional journey through serene and tumultuous landscapes encapsulated in music.
Beethoven composed this masterpiece in 1801, dedicated to his pupil, Countess Giulietta Guicciardi. Today, the sonata continues to inspire music enthusiasts worldwide with its profound beauty and emotional depth.
